Bulletin I2072/B
SD1100C..C SERIES
STANDARD RECOVERY DIODES
Hockey Puk Version
Features
Wide current range
High voltage ratings up to 3200V
High surge current capabilities
Diffused junction
Hockey Puk version
Case style B-43
1400A
Typical Applications
Converters
Power supplies
Machine tool controls
High power drives
Medium traction applications
